Synthesis of isoxazoles by hypervalent iodine-induced cycloaddition of nitrile oxides to alkynes
作者:Anup M. Jawalekar、Erik Reubsaet、Floris P. J. T. Rutjes、Floris L. van Delft
DOI:10.1039/c0cc04646a
日期:——
Treatment of oximes with hypervalent iodine leads to substituted isoxazoles via rapid formation of nitrile oxides. Reaction with terminal alkynes led to a series of 3,5-disubstituted isoxazoles with complete regioselectivity and high yield, in a procedure mild enough to prepare a range of nucleoside and peptide conjugates.
